Among your local craft beer options for Valentine's Day:

Perry Street is offering two pints, an appetizer, two entrees and chocolate mousse for dessert for $45.

Iron Goat's special includes two beers, a pizza and a dessert to share for $30.

Paradise Creek has happy-hour beer pricing and $3 off menu items all day starting at 1:30.

Pilgrim's has a free tasting of Lindemans' Framboise (raspberry) and strawberry lambics plus Samuel Smith's Organic Chocolate Stout.

– Valentine's Day at Downdraft from 6 to 8 will include speed dating (sign up in advance), drink specials and food from My Big Fat Greek Deli. 

– Fort George's 1,000 Years of Silence, a Mexican chocolate imperial stout, will be tapped for Community Pint's Bloody Valentine Show from 7 to 9 along with live music.

– Buy one pint for $3 at Steady Flow Growler House and get a second for half off.

Hopped Up is tapping a small-batch Rocky Road Valentine Porter infused with chocolate, marshmallow and almond.

Badass Backyard has its Daring Diva raspberry wheat on nitro.
